Tencent Science and Technology (slides) Beijing time May 9 News, according to the network edition of Wired magazine report, Intel Wednesday announced that its fourth generation Haswell processor will support 4K resolution. Analysts say that if Intel combines Haswell processor technology with the upcoming TV set-top box, it will be expected to release the world's first truly 4K content device. The Haswell processor supports 4K resolution, which is a great news for the PC industry. And if Intel can integrate the technology into the upcoming set-top box, that would be better news. With Iris Graphics technology and upcoming set-top boxes, Intel is expected to release the world's first truly 4K content device. In the process of switching to 4K resolution in the television industry, consumers need a device that really pushes 4 K content to the TV. With 3D technology not as hot as before, TV makers are pushing 4K (also known as Super HD) to become the technology selling point for next-generation TVs. Today, you can spend 5000 of dollars on a Sony 4K TV, but it's hard to find content and not enough powerful devices to play it. Of course, Sony launched a 700-dollar 4K Media player, but it only applies to Sony TV, and only built-in a 4K resolution of the film "The Extraordinary Spider-Man." Intel has been refusing to disclose the details of its set-top box and TV subscription service, but it has pledged that its set-top box and TV services will have more cost-effective binding packages than cable and satellite service providers. Erik Huggers, Intel Media Vice president, said at the dive into media conference that Intel's set-top box would have an advanced user interface and support streaming media applications such as Netflix and Amazon Eric Hugers. With 4K features, Intel set-top box will become a truly future-oriented video device. With an HDMI interface and a broadband network, your 4K TV will enjoy more hyper-high-definition video. Intel's set-top box plans to transmit TV content over the Internet, which will have a huge impact on cable service providers that monopolize the local market. In addition, since the latest HEVC (h.265) encoding reduces the rate of 4 K-resolution video from 45-50mbps to 10Mbps, users will be more easily transmitting 60fps 4K content over the Internet. According to the Western Data network experts, 20Mbps broadband is enough to support the new 4K resolution content of streaming media playback. Several television networks are testing live broadcasts at 4 K-resolution, but sources say there is still time to really launch 4K content live and stream media broadcasts from major television networks. ' Netflix will pay close attention to the development of 4K technology, ' said Teide Salando, a chief content officer at Netflix, in an interview recently Sarandos. Neil Hunt, chief product officer at Netflix, says streaming media will be the most Neil to watch 4K videoGood way, and will be achieved in a year or two. In addition, the second quarter of Netflix's "card house" will be encoded in a 4 K resolution. Of course, all of this is premised on the fact that you already have an expensive 4K TV and the size must be greater than 60 inches, otherwise you will not be able to detect resolution elevation. Also, if you really want to watch the highest-resolution video and have a good enough TV screen, you'll need a 4K set-top box. The age of 4K content will come, whether you need it or not. Intel has the technology necessary to lead this 4K trend, and all it needs to do is integrate these technologies.
